Roofline cleaning services involve removing dirt, algae, moss, mold, and other debris that can accumulate along the edges of a roof and the fascia boards. This process typically includes carefully washing or scrubbing the roof’s surface and the gutters to eliminate buildup that can cause staining or damage over time. Professional contractors use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ions designed to safely and effectively restore the appearance of the roof and prevent issues related to neglect or environmental exposure.

One of the primary problems roofline cleaning helps address is the growth of moss and algae, which can hold moisture against roofing materials and lead to premature deterioration. Additionally, accumulated dirt and organic matter can cause unsightly staining, reducing curb appeal. By removing these substances, homeowners can help protect their roof’s structural integrity and maintain a cleaner, more attractive exterior. Regular cleaning can also prevent issues such as clogged gutters or water damage caused by debris buildup.

This service is often used on resid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it buildings. It is especially beneficial for homes in areas with high humidity or frequent rainfall, where moss and algae tend to grow more rapidly. Property owners who notice dark streaks, green patches, or debris along their roof’s edge and gutters may find roofline cleaning to be a practical solution. It’s also a common step in routine exterior maintenance, helping to preserve the overall condition and app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Roofline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Green Bay,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or roofline cleaning projects in Green Bay range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as cleaning gutters or small sections,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her tiers unless additional repairs are needed.

Standard Roofline Cleaning - For average-sized homes and straightforward cleaning tasks,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. This range covers most common roofline maintenance jobs in the area.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range but are less frequent.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ive roofline cleaning, including multiple stories or heavily stained areas, can cost from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ects are less common and typically involve additional preparation or specialized equipment.

Full Roofline Replacement - Complete replacement of roofline components, such as soffits and fascia, can range from $3,000 to over $5,000. These projects are less typical and generally involve significant structural work or upgrades in the Green Bay area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What does roofline cleaning include? Roofline cleaning typically involves removing dirt, mold, algae, and debris from the edges of a roof, gutters, and fascia to improve appearance and prevent damage.

Is roofline cleaning safe for my roof and gutters? When performed by experienced service providers, roofline cleaning is generally safe and helps maintain the integrity of your roof and gutter system.

How often should roofline cleaning be done? The frequency of roofline cleaning can vary based on local conditions, but many homeowners opt for a cleaning annually or biannually to keep their roofline in good condition.

Can roofline cleaning prevent damage to my home? Yes, regular cleaning can help prevent issues such as gutter clogs, fascia rot, and mold growth that may lead to more costly repairs.
